The Aquatics AV units are absolutely plug and play via your OEM 23 pin connector. On a simple two speaker (in fairing) Street or Road Glide installation you simple remove the 23 pin connector and antenna cable from the OEM HK unit and remove the HK unit from the bike. Four screws only. Simply reverse the process using the Aquatics AV unit. If your HK head was working with handlebar controls your new Aquatics will. There is no wiring involved. Plug in your old HK unit again. If the handle bar controls work your 23 pin connection is fine and the Aquatics AV is the problem. You can easily do this yourself.
